New Zones and Expanded Gameplay
The Breach update takes players to new heights by offering additional handcrafted zones, which promise to expand the already intricate world design of the game. These new areas not only provide fresh landscapes to explore but are also rich with quests and captivating story cinematics that deepen the narrative experience.
An exciting addition to the game is the introduction of spellcasting, available for the first time through the use of wands. This feature promises to diversify combat strategies, allowing players to harness the power of magical spells alongside traditional combat tactics.

A Fresh Start for Newcomers
With the game currently available at a discount, there’s never been a better time for new players to jump into No Rest for The Wicked. To facilitate this influx of new adventurers, the developers have also rolled out an improved tutorial. This enhancement ensures that beginners can quickly understand the game mechanics and fully immerse themselves in this richly detailed world.
